Hi folks,
I'm delighted to announce the general availability of pg_textsearch v1.0. This is an open source extension (Postgres license) supporting modern BM25 ranked keyword search with fast indexing and state-of-the-art query performance:
[https://github.com/timescale/pg_textsearch](https://github.com/timescale/pg_textsearch)
In the blog post accompanying today's launch, I describe the extension's motivation, architecture, and benchmark results on large scale IR datasets. These demonstrate substantial performance advantages vs ParadeDB, which has a much more restrictive license (AGPL):
[https://www.tigerdata.com/blog/pg-textsearch-bm25-full-text-search-postgres](https://www.tigerdata.com/blog/pg-textsearch-bm25-full-text-search-postgres)
